在这篇文章中,我们将介绍如何设置和使用韩国的 npm 镜像。这一操作可以有效提升 npm 包的下载速度,尤其是对于在国内访问 npm 官方源时遇到的慢速或不稳定的问题。通过使用韩国的 npm 镜像,我们可以享受更快速和更稳定的包管理体验。以下将详细介绍准备工作、配置步骤以及遇到的问题和解决方案。
操作前的准备
在开始之前,你需要确保以下条件满足:
- 已安装 Node.js 和 npm:你可以通过以下命令查看是否已安装:
node -v
npm -v
如果没有安装,可以前往 Node.js 官网下载安装。
配置韩国 npm 镜像
接下来,我们将进行 npm 镜像源的配置。韩国的 npm 镜像通常由 npm.taobao.org 提供,不过为了更快速的访问,可以使用 https://npm.korea.com 镜像(请根据实际情况选择具体的镜像源)。
步骤 1:设置镜像源
使用以下命令将 npm 的源设置为韩国镜像:
npm config set registry https://npm.korea.com
这个命令会修改你的 npm 配置文件,确保所有后续的 npm 操作都使用这个新的源。
步骤 2:验证镜像设置
你可以通过以下命令来验证新的源是否设置成功:
npm config get registry
如果输出是 https://npm.korea.com,说明配置成功。
步骤 3:清除缓存
在更改源后,我们建议清除 npm 的缓存,以确保不使用旧的缓存文件:

npm cache clean --force
安装 npm 包
现在,一切已准备就绪,你可以开始安装 npm 包了。例如,安装 express 框架,就可以使用以下命令:
npm install express
通过指定源,你会发现下载体验更加流畅。
可能遇到的问题
在使用韩国 npm 镜像的过程中,可能会遇到一些问题,以下是常见问题及解决方案:
问题 1:网络连接失败
如果你在使用时遇到网络连接失败的问题,请确认以下几点:
- 确保网络连接正常。
- 检查 VPN 或防火墙设置,确保它们不会阻止对 npm 镜像的访问。
问题 2:包无法找到
有时可能会有一些包在镜像源上不可用。遇到这种情况时,可以尝试以下策略:
- 回退到官方源:
npm config set registry https://registry.npmjs.org
实用技巧
以下是一些使用 npm 镜像的实用技巧,可以帮助你更有效地管理你的 npm 包:
- 使用 npm ci:如果你在构建项目时,需要更快的安装速度,使用 npm ci 而不是 npm install。
- 并行安装:可以使用 npm install –parallel 来加速多个包的安装。
- 经常更新 npm:确保使用最新版本的 npm,这样可以享有更好的性能和错误修复。
通过以上步骤和技巧,你应该能够顺利配置和使用韩国的 npm 镜像,以实现更快的包安装和更新速度。如果你有其他问题或想了解更多,欢迎通过评论与我们联系。